Standard Toilet Paper Roll Height

When it comes to toilet paper roll dimensions, the standard height is around 4.5 inches or 11.4 centimeters. This measurement may vary slightly depending on the brand, but it is generally accepted as the norm. Understanding this standard and other toilet paper roll measurements is important for choosing the right holder and ensuring a proper fit in your bathroom.

Another innovation in toilet paper roll height is the introduction of coreless rolls. By removing the cardboard tube from the center, manufacturers can increase the amount of usable toilet paper and reduce waste. These rolls can also be smaller in height, making them ideal for small bathrooms or travel.
